HOW YOU WILL MAKE THIS A GREAT PLACE TO WORK

The Accounts Receivable (A/R) Specialist will be responsible for performing a variety of clerical and technical accounting duties to ensure accuracy and efficiency of the A/R Department. This position requires someone who is detail-oriented, accurate in their work, and has a strong desire to build their accounting acumen.

SOME OF WHAT WE ENTRUST YOU TO DO

  • Assist in the management of the daily A/R functions.

  • Proactively assist in meeting our contractual obligations in relation to billings, job costs and managing accounts receivables.

  • Set up jobs and related contracts in accounting software.

  • Process draft invoice for review and approval

  • Review and maintain billing terms.

  • Ensure client requirements are met.

  • Ensure client billing guidelines are reviewed, documented, and adhered to.

  • Organize & sort data for invoice creation.

  • Run reports needed for weekly billing.

  • Maintain AR tracker.

  • Assist the Project Managers with job related documentation.

  • Assist with the tracking of change orders and customer contracts.

  • Communicate with management on the status of all receivables, approved, aging and unapproved.

  • Perform collection calls on open accounts receivable as needed.

  • Review job billings for accuracy

  • Assist in process of accounts receivable with tasks such as reconciling, preparing and processing of invoices.

  • Maintain accounts receivable, collections and unbilled in accordance with accounting procedures.

  • Develop and maintain strong customer relations.

  • Cross train other employees in daily tasks.
